What is operational audit?

Process to determine ways to improve production. Contrast with external-audit, which relates to financial statements.Operational audit focuses on managerial effectiveness rather than accuracy of financial reports.

Is it true that chart of accounts for a merchandising entity differs from that of a service entity?

Yes, the chart of accounts for a merchandising entity typically differs from that of a service entity. A merchandising entity includes accounts related to inventory, cost of goods sold, and sales revenue from physical products, while a service entity focuses on accounts related to service revenue and expenses associated with providing services. This distinction reflects the different nature of their operations and financial reporting needs.

What are the tools used to working capital management?

Some of the tools used for working capital management include cash flow forecasting, accounts receivable management, inventory control, and accounts payable management. Cash flow forecasting helps in predicting future cash inflows and outflows, enabling effective management of cash. Accounts receivable management involves monitoring and collecting payments from customers in a timely manner. Inventory control focuses on optimizing the level of inventory to avoid excess or shortage. Accounts payable management involves managing and negotiating payment terms with suppliers to optimize cash flow.
